Jordan Moore commented on KAFKA-12534:
--------------------------------------

The config warnings should be fixed with KAFKA-10090

The error says it failed to load the keystore, so the properties are definitely 
being read, and something with your files are incorrect, for example, maybe the 
double slash in the listed file path or the file permissions themselves

> We are trying to change the trust store password on the fly using the 
> kafka-configs script for a ssl enabled kafka broker.
> Below is the command used:
> kafka-configs.sh --bootstrap-server localhost:9092 --entity-type brokers 
> --entity-name 1001 --alter --add-config 'ssl.truststore.password=xxx'
> But we see below error in the broker logs when the command is run.
> {"type":"log", "host":"kf-2-0", "level":"INFO", 
> "neid":"kafka-cfd5ccf2af7f47868e83473408", "system":"kafka", 
> "time":"2021-03-23T12:14:40.055", "timezone":"UTC", 
> "log":\{"message":"data-plane-kafka-network-thread-1002-ListenerName(SSL)-SSL-2
>  - org.apache.kafka.common.network.Selector - [SocketServer brokerId=1002] 
> Failed authentication with /127.0.0.1 (SSL handshake failed)"}}
>  How can anyone configure ssl certs for the kafka-configs script and succeed 
> with the ssl handshake in this case ? 
> Note : 
> We are trying with a single listener i.e SSL:
